--[[
This directory is the luaUtils template.
You can choose what things from it that you would like to use.
And then delete the rest.
Everything in this directory is optional.
--]]
local M = {}
-- NOTE: If you don't use lazy.nvim, you don't need this file.
---lazy.nvim wrapper
---@overload fun(nixLazyPath: string|nil, lazySpec: any, opts: table)
---@overload fun(nixLazyPath: string|nil, opts: table)
function M.setup(nixLazyPath, lazySpec, opts)
local lazySpecs = nil
local lazyCFG = nil
if opts == nil and type(lazySpec) == "table" and lazySpec.spec then
lazyCFG = lazySpec
else
lazySpecs = lazySpec
lazyCFG = opts
end
local function regularLazyDownload()
local lazypath = vim.fn.stdpath("data") .. "/lazy/lazy.nvim"
if not vim.loop.fs_stat(lazypath) then
vim.fn.system {
'git',
'clone',
'--filter=blob:none',
'https://github.com/folke/lazy.nvim.git',
'--branch=stable', -- latest stable release
lazypath,
}
end
return lazypath
end
local isNixCats = vim.g[ [[nixCats-special-rtp-entry-nixCats]] ] ~= nil
local lazypath
if not isNixCats then
-- No nixCats? Not nix. Do it normally
lazypath = regularLazyDownload()
vim.opt.rtp:prepend(lazypath)
else
local nixCats = require('nixCats')
-- Else, its nix, so we wrap lazy with a few extra config options
lazypath = nixLazyPath
-- and also we probably dont have to download lazy either
if lazypath == nil then
lazypath = regularLazyDownload()
end
local oldPath
local lazypatterns
local fallback
if type(lazyCFG) == "table" and type(lazyCFG.dev) == "table" then
lazypatterns = lazyCFG.dev.patterns
fallback = lazyCFG.dev.fallback
oldPath = lazyCFG.dev.path
end
local myNeovimPackages = nixCats.vimPackDir .. "/pack/myNeovimPackages"
local newLazyOpts = {
performance = {
rtp = {
reset = false,
},
},
dev = {
path = function(plugin)
local path = nil
if type(oldPath) == "string" and vim.fn.isdirectory(oldPath .. "/" .. plugin.name) == 1 then
path = oldPath .. "/" .. plugin.name
elseif type(oldPath) == "function" then
path = oldPath(plugin)
if type(path) ~= "string" then
path = nil
end
end
if path == nil then
if vim.fn.isdirectory(myNeovimPackages .. "/start/" .. plugin.name) == 1 then
path = myNeovimPackages .. "/start/" .. plugin.name
elseif vim.fn.isdirectory(myNeovimPackages .. "/opt/" .. plugin.name) == 1 then
path = myNeovimPackages .. "/opt/" .. plugin.name
else
path = "~/projects/" .. plugin.name
end
end
return path
end,
patterns = lazypatterns or { "" },
fallback = fallback == nil and true or fallback,
}
}
lazyCFG = vim.tbl_deep_extend("force", lazyCFG or {}, newLazyOpts)
-- do the reset we disabled without removing important stuff
local cfgdir = nixCats.configDir
vim.opt.rtp = {
cfgdir,
nixCats.nixCatsPath,
nixCats.pawsible.allPlugins.ts_grammar_path,
vim.fn.stdpath("data") .. "/site",
lazypath,
vim.env.VIMRUNTIME,
vim.fn.fnamemodify(vim.v.progpath, ":p:h:h") .. "/lib/nvim",
cfgdir .. "/after",
}
end
if lazySpecs then
require('lazy').setup(lazySpecs, lazyCFG)
else
require('lazy').setup(lazyCFG)
end
end
return M
